POSITION OBJECTIVE: To provide leadership and exceptional communication to Club Red Ambassadors in support of delivering tremendous guest service, accurate transactions, and the selling of Club Red membership benefits.
Our Mission: To enhance continued economic viability and quality of life for the Nisqually Indian Tribe, our Team Members, and the neighboring communities.
Our Vision: Creating incredible experiences.
Our Core Values: Integrity, Communication, Accountability, Respect, Teamwork
JOB SUMMARY:
Trains, monitors performance, provides corrective guidance and leadership to the Ambassador team of the Nisqually Red Wind Casino Players Club. The Lead Ambassador interacts with players for all escalated issues regarding program benefits and promotions, and utilizes the player tracking system for reporting, and ensures proper completion of all promotional drawing related activities and transactions. Performs all duties of an Ambassador as needed, as well as additional support of other marketing tasks as assigned. Complies with casino policies and procedures, internal controls and Tribal Gaming regulations pertaining to Club operations.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S OF THE JOB:
- Reviews and maintains expert knowledge of all monthly promotions, players club benefits, and Red Wind Casino offerings.
- Ensure accurate completion of all drawings and promotional activities, including drawing processes, execution, reporting, required paperwork and regulations.
- Ensure compliance with all Players Club policies, procedures and controls.
- Assist Club Red Supervisor in the daily operations of all Club Red activities and daily tasks.
- Assists with marketing administrative duties and reporting as assigned.
- Provides training and onboarding of all new Club Red personnel.
- Assist guests with any guest service issues and direct them to the appropriate places.
- Provides in-service training for Ambassadors, retraining for deficient performance.
- Monitors performance and reports back to supervisor.
- Assist in obtaining jackpot photos of guests for advertising purposes.
- Increase carded play among guests by finding opportunities to sell/upsell Club Red benefits and educate guests on the advantages of carded play.
- Provides excellent customer service, in a busy, fast-paced casino environment.
- Performs all duties of Ambassador as needed.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
